About Canlan Sports

Canlan Sports is dedicated to creating environments where individuals connect through the joy of play, championing the belief that everyone deserves a team. As North America's largest private owner and operator of recreational sports facilities, Canlan manages 15 multi-sport complexes with over 70 playing surfaces across Canada and the United States. Our offerings range from ice, court, turf to digital sports, all designed to foster community, build connections, and positively impact lives.

Job Overview

The Sports Management Intern will support operations involving the complex's Customer Relationship Management (CRM) system, assist in managing ice contracts, spot rentals, and tournaments, and collaborate with various teams to plan and implement sports programs. Key responsibilities include supporting Sales and Customer Care management to maintain existing contracts, strategizing revenue growth, and ensuring an exceptional customer experience aligned with our standards.

Key Responsibilities

  • Assist in maintaining and updating the CRM system associated with ice contracts, spot rentals, and both third-party and internal tournaments.
  • Under guidance from the Sales and Customer Care Manager, aid in crafting and executing a comprehensive direct sales strategy aimed at driving revenue through targeted sales and marketing efforts.
  • Support the identification and cultivation of new customer relationships while maximizing revenue from current clientele.
  • Contribute to league operations by helping plan and execute activities.
  • Assist in organizing and delivering sports camps and programs alongside the leagues and programs team.
  • Work under managerial supervision to ensure customers receive a top-tier experience, with attention to care and satisfaction.
  • Perform additional duties as assigned.

Desired Attributes and Experience

  • Prior experience in customer service or office administration.
  • Comfort with adopting new technologies and systems; familiarity with CRM software is advantageous.
  • Ability to manage stress and meet tight deadlines while maintaining quality work.
  • Proficiency with Microsoft 365 applications.
  • Detail-oriented, well-organized, clear communicator, punctual, and articulate.
  • Strong oral and written communication skills paired with a professional and positive demeanor.
  • Capable of handling and resolving challenging situations tactfully.
  • Currently enrolled in a post-secondary educational program that includes a co-op component.

Internship Details

  • Term: Fall Semester (September to December 2026).
  • This is an unpaid internship; however, a stipend opportunity is available contingent upon successful completion.
